Structural plasticity and enhanced fear extinction following psilocybin in chronically stressed mice

The classic psychedelic psilocybin elicits long-lasting neural plasticity and behavioral effects, but prior studies largely examined stress-naive animals. Using longitudinal imaging, we show that psilocybin increases dendritic spine density in frontal cortical neurons and facilitates fear extinction after chronic restraint stress, demonstrating psilocybins effects in a translationally relevant mouse model.
